**Q: How do I deduplicate customer records in Merrowdesk?**

A: Use the Match Review queue rather than deleting records directly. The matcher flags pairs by name, postcode, and order history; always confirm that billing histories agree before merging, since a bad merge cannot be undone. Merges are logged under the Dedupe audit tab. If the Match Review queue itself is locked because a previous merge failed midway, you must unlock it with the recovery passphrase, which is:

vault phrase of kafog-kahif = holdor-rusir-praox

## Service Account: svc-lexigrab

This account runs the translation-string extraction script for the Quillset app. It scans source files nightly, pushes new strings to the Phrasevault service, and opens a review request when keys change. Reviewers should confirm no hardcoded strings slipped through. The script authenticates to Phrasevault with the key below.

app token of yajeg-kawef = kto11_7En3XSX8xQw

Handover — Contrast Audit, Brightquill UI

Hi — picking up where Marisol left off. The color-contrast audit covers all Brightquill dashboard themes; spreadsheet tab three lists failing pairs (mostly muted grays on the slate theme, ratios under 3:1). Please verify fixes with the internal checker before marking rows done. To open the audit vault, enter the passphrase below.

recovery phrase for tahop-kawig: sorwyn-istox-briiel